Packaging carton
The packaging boxes designed using origami techniques utilize a double-layer cardboard structure to provide cushioning protection, solving the negative environmental impact of pearl cotton or bubble wrap, and achieving an environmentally friendly and highly efficient cushioning effect.

TECHNICAL FIELD
[0001] The application belongs to the technical field of packaging boxes, and particularly relates to a packaging paper box. BACKGROUND
[0002] When a product is packaged by using a packaging box, generally, pearl wool or a bubble bag is placed in the packaging box for buffering, so as to enhance the protection of the product. However, the large use of pearl wool or a bubble bag will cause adverse effects on the ecological environment, and therefore, a packaging box structure scheme capable of reducing the use of related buffering materials and providing sufficient buffering effect needs to be proposed. CONTENT OF THE UTILITY MODEL
[0003] The application aims to provide a packaging paper box capable of reducing the use of related buffering materials such as pearl wool or a bubble bag and providing sufficient buffering effect.
[0004] To achieve the above-mentioned purpose, the application adopts the technical scheme of a packaging paper box comprising a bottom plate, a closed top plate, a side wall plate assembly, a first buffering plate and a second buffering plate. The side wall plate assembly is located between the bottom plate and the closed top plate, and the side wall plate assembly, the bottom plate and the closed top plate enclose a receiving cavity. The bottom plate extends out of the receiving cavity, and first and second buffering portions are respectively formed on opposite sides of the side wall plate assembly. The opposite sides of the first buffering plate are respectively integrally connected with the side wall plate assembly and the first buffering portion, and the first buffering plate is folded with the first buffering portion. The opposite sides of the second buffering plate are respectively integrally connected with the side wall plate assembly and the second buffering portion, and the second buffering plate is folded with the second buffering portion.

[0018] Compared with the prior art, the packaging carton has the beneficial effects that the receiving cavity enclosed by the bottom plate, the closed top plate and the side wall assembly is used for receiving products to be packaged, when the packaging carton falls, the first buffer part and the second buffer part of the bottom plate located at opposite sides of the side wall assembly and the first buffer plate and the second buffer plate folded on the first buffer part and the second buffer part can play a buffering role, thereby protecting the four corners of the products in the receiving cavity. The bottom plate, the side wall assembly, the first buffer plate and the second buffer plate connected in one piece are obtained by folding, the double-layer paperboard structure composed of the first buffer plate and the first buffer part and the double-layer paperboard structure composed of the second buffer plate and the second buffer part can realize the buffering function, sufficient buffering effect can be provided without using pearl wool or bubble bags to meet the environmental protection requirement, and the packaging carton has the advantages of high structural stability, simple manufacturing, low manufacturing cost and high production efficiency. [0043] In combination Figure 1 , Figure 2 and Figure 3As shown, the packaging carton provided by the embodiment of the present application comprises a bottom plate 10, a closed top plate 20, a side wall plate assembly 30, a first buffer plate 40 and a second buffer plate 80. The side wall plate assembly 30 is located between the bottom plate 10 and the closed top plate 20 assembly, and the side wall plate assembly 30, the bottom plate 10 and the closed top plate 20 enclose a receiving cavity. The bottom plate 10 extends out of the receiving cavity, and a first buffer portion 11 and a second buffer portion 12 are respectively formed on opposite sides of the side wall plate assembly 30. The opposite sides of the first buffer plate 40 are integrally connected with the side wall plate assembly 30 and the first buffer portion 11, respectively. The first buffer plate 40 is folded with the first buffer portion 11. The opposite sides of the second buffer plate 80 are integrally connected with the side wall plate assembly 30 and the second buffer portion 12, respectively. The second buffer plate 80 is folded with the second buffer portion 12.
[0044] The receiving cavity enclosed by the bottom plate 10, the closed top plate 20 and the side wall plate assembly 30 is used to accommodate products that need to be packaged. When the packaging carton falls, the first buffer portion 11 and the second buffer portion 12 of the bottom plate 10 located on opposite sides of the side wall plate assembly 30, and the first buffer plate 40 and the second buffer plate 80 folded on the first buffer portion 11 and the second buffer portion 12, respectively, can play a buffering role, thereby protecting the four corners of the products in the receiving cavity. The bottom plate 10, the side wall plate assembly 30, the first buffer plate 40 and the second buffer plate 80 integrally connected by the folding method can provide sufficient buffering effect without using pearl wool or bubble bags to meet the environmental protection requirements, and have the advantages of high structural stability, simple manufacturing, low manufacturing cost and high production efficiency.
[0045] The structure of the packaging carton provided by the embodiment after being completely unfolded is shown in Figure 7 At this time, the bottom plate 10, the first buffer plate 40, the second buffer plate 80 and the side wall plate assembly 30 are all in the same plane. When manufacturing the packaging carton, the dashed line part is folded, the first buffer plate 40 is folded 180° to be folded above the first buffer portion 11 of the bottom plate 10, the second buffer plate 80 is folded 180° to be folded above the second buffer portion 12 of the bottom plate 10, and the side wall plate assembly 30 is folded to make the side wall plate assembly 30 perpendicular to the first buffer plate 40 and the second buffer plate 80.

[0062] Specifically, a crack can be opened on the first paperboard 62, a small piece can be cut out of the fourth paperboard 65, and the small piece can be inserted into the crack, thereby achieving fixation of the first paperboard 62 and the fourth paperboard 65.
[0063] In one embodiment, combined Figure 1 and Figure 3As shown, the top paperboard assembly 60 is provided with a plug-in slot (not shown), and the packaging carton further comprises a fixed top plate 70 integrally connected with the top paperboard assembly 60 at two third vertical plates 33 respectively, the fixed top plate 70 is provided with a plug-in block 71, and the fixed top plate 70 is stacked on the top of the top paperboard assembly 60, and the plug-in block 71 is inserted into the plug-in slot. By inserting the plug-in block 71 of the fixed top plate 70 into the plug-in slot of the top paperboard assembly 60, the fixed top plate 70 and the top paperboard assembly 60 are fixed, so as to maintain the final shape of the entire packaging carton.
[0064] Specifically, the plug-in slot is arranged in the first paperboard 62 in the top paperboard assembly 60, the fixed top plate 70 is folded on the first paperboard 62, and the fixed top plate 70 overlaps the first paperboard 62, and the part of the fixed top plate 70 protruding out of the closed top plate 20 also plays a buffering role to protect the four corners of the product in the receiving cavity.
[0065] The structure of the packaging carton provided by the embodiment after being completely unfolded is shown in Figure 7 As shown, the bottom plate 10, the first buffer plate 40, the second buffer plate 80, the first vertical plate 31, the second vertical plate 32, the third vertical plate 33, the third buffer plate 51, the fourth buffer plate 91, the first connecting plate 52, the second connecting plate 92, the fifth buffer plate 53, the sixth buffer plate 93, the closed top plate 20, the first paperboard 62, the second paperboard 63, the third paperboard 64, the fourth paperboard 65 and the fixed top plate 70 are all in the same plane. The manufacturing of the packaging carton comprises the following steps:
[0066] I. Manufacturing the top paperboard assembly 60. Specifically, first fold the fourth paperboard 65 to be perpendicular to the third paperboard 64, then fold the third paperboard 64 to be perpendicular to the second paperboard 63, and then fold the second paperboard 63 to be perpendicular to the first paperboard 62, so as to obtain the top paperboard assembly 60 in a square frame structure, in addition, a slit can be opened on the first paperboard 62, and a small piece is cut out on the fourth paperboard 65, and the small piece is inserted into the slit, so as to fix the first paperboard 62 and the fourth paperboard 65.
[0067] II. Forming the receiving cavity. Specifically, fold the first upright plate 31, the first buffer plate 40, the second upright plate 32, the second buffer plate 80, the third buffer plate 51, the first connecting plate 52, the fifth buffer plate 53, the fourth buffer plate 91, the second connecting plate 92, the sixth buffer plate 93, the two third upright plates 33, and the two closing top plates 20, so that one of the closing top plates 20 is perpendicular to the first upright plate 31, the first upright plate 31 is perpendicular to the first buffer plate 40, the first buffer plate 40 is folded with the first buffer part 11 of the bottom plate 10, the two third upright plates 33 are perpendicular to the bottom plate 10, the third buffer plate 51 is folded with the third buffer part 331 of the third upright plate 33, the first connecting plate 52 is folded with the third buffer plate 51, the fifth buffer plate 53 is folded with the first connecting plate 52, and meanwhile, the other closing top plate 20 is perpendicular to the second upright plate 32, the second upright plate 32 is perpendicular to the second buffer plate 80, the second buffer plate 80 is folded with the second buffer part 12 of the bottom plate 10, the fourth buffer plate 91 is folded with the fourth buffer part 332 of the third upright plate 33, the second connecting plate 92 is folded with the fourth buffer plate 91, and the sixth buffer plate 93 is folded with the second connecting plate 92.
[0068] III. Folding the top paperboard assembly 60, so that the top paperboard assembly 60 is folded on top of the closing top plate 20.
[0069] IV. Folding the fixing top plate 70, so that the fixing top plate 70 is folded on top of the top paperboard assembly 60, and the insertion block 71 of the fixing top plate 70 is inserted into the insertion slot of the top paperboard assembly 60, thereby realizing the fixation of the fixing top plate 70 and the top paperboard assembly 60, so as to maintain the final form of the entire packaging carton.
